Premier League holders Liverpool struggling in EPL as well as Champions League this season
David James feels quality of opposition has improved and practice time available is less
Robbie Fowler points to history, suggesting it is really hard to win the English top-flight for back-to-back seasons
A number of pundits and football writers tipped Liverpool to retain their Premier League crown for the 2025-26 season, as well as go on to lift the Champions League trophy.
The fact that around 450 million pounds were spent in the transfer window by the club's owners to revamp their squad was certainly a factor.
